Plumbing issues follow the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Street, initial actors iron can be rough within, like sandpaper to oil and dust. Those pipelines were indicated for a various period of soaps and water usage. Gradually, interior scaling narrows the diameter, and all congealed fat or coffee ground has even more locations to capture. Farther west towards Seminary Roadway and Beauregard, post-war residential or commercial properties commonly have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ewer laterals that have lived past their comfort zone. Clay areas change at joints and invite hairline origin intrusion. The roots prosper where grass irrigation and structure growings keep the soil damp.
On top of products and age, Alexandria sees broad swings between soaking storms and droughts. After hefty rain, sump pumps push even more water towards major lines, and any type of weakness in a sewer comes to be visible. Throughout cold snaps, oil in kitchen area runs becomes a ceraceous cork. The city's slim streets and shared easements make complex gain access to. A professional drain cleaning company that works below regularly discovers to stage devices with minimal footprint,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out access, and plan for the old-house peculiarities that do not show up in a textbook.

After the walk-through, the work divides into accessibility, diagnosis, and elimination. Accessibility depends upon the fixture and where the clog is, however cleanouts are the most effective beginning point. If a home does not have usable cleanouts, it may need pulling a toilet or removing a trap. For diagnosis, professionals count on two tools as a baseline: a cable television machine and a cam. The wire figures out whether the line is openable. The video camera reveals why it obtained ob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.
Cable work has its drain cleaning service own finesse. On a kitchen line, wire choice issues due to the fact that soft cables penetrate via grease and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scuffing a clean course. A stiffer cord with a correctly sized blade has a tendency to reduce as opposed to poke holes, which implies the line stays clear longer. In cast iron, oscillating and step-by-step forward stress stays clear of gouging a currently thin wall. In clay laterals with origins, you do not wish to ram the cable television so hard that it widens a joint. The objective is regulated reducing, not brute force.
Once circulation is restored, the camera levels. I have actually found offsets that just obstruct when a cleaning equipment discharges at full rate, and stubborn bellies that hold just sufficient water to trap paper for weeks. Without a camera, you may think the obstruction is arbitrary and brace for the next one. With video, you know whether you need a repair work, a hydro jetting service, or simply far better habits.
Clogged drains pipes are not a solitary group. Hair in a bathtub waste requires a different touch than lint sn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Easy hair clogs react to hand-operated removal and a short cable run. If the tub has an old trip-lever setting up with a rusty springtime, that device might be the real trouble, catching hair like a rake. Changing the assembly while the line is open avoids the repeat call.
Kitchen sinks are the war zone. Modern recipe soaps reduced oil far better than they used to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ipe walls. DIY enzyme items have their area for upkeep, however they can not dig deep into hard fats that have cooled and layered. On a grease line, a two-step method works best: mechanical cutting to reclaim circulation, after that a regulated hot water flush to rinse put on hold fats downstream. If the grease extends into the major, or if the accumulation is hefty and split, hydro jetting becomes a smarter option than repeated cabling.
Toilets present their own puzzles. A single clog after an ill-advised flush of wipes is one point. Repetitive blockages indicate a trap layout probl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ction beyond the wardrobe bend. I have actually discovered plaything dinosaurs wedged past the trap, unidentified to the homeowner, that only created troubles when paper stuck behind them. A video camera with a little head can slide past the commode flange after drawing the component, and that five-minute appearance can conserve you replacing a whole toilet that is blameless.
Basement flooring drains and washing standpipes frequently deceive. When both backup, many people think the main drain is blocked. Sometimes that is true. Other times a check valve has actually stopped working,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that discards a rise. A major drain cleaning service tests fixtures one at a time, watches flows, and associates the timing of backups. If the line holds during low-flow fixtures but burps throughout a washer cycle, capacity, not outright clog, is your villain.
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, commonly in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ied through a hose p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and scours the pipe wall surface, and the back jets pull the tube forward while purging debris back to the cleanout. For heavy grease and split scale, it is extra efficient than cabling because it cleanses the full area of the pipe.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ens up the line extra evenly than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to catch paper.
Jetting brings its very own policies. Pipe condition dictates stress and nozzle option. In fragile actors iron with obvious thinning, make use of reduced stress and a spinning nozzle that brightens rather than blades. In more recent PVC, greater stress with a warthog or comparable nozzle clears sludge fast without risk. A seasoned technology evaluates just how swiftly the line is removing by the feel of the tube, the noise of return water, and the debris leaving the cleanout. If sand or aggregate puts out, you may be handling a broken pipe or a flattened area, and every min of jetting should be stabilized against the threat of cleaning more bed linen away.
The ideal use instance for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the major drainpipe with scale and paper problems, and business lines that see constant food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Opportunity know the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ps solution undisturbed. For a property owner with repeating cooking area sink back-ups every three months, a single jetting often resets the clock for a year or more, provided the line is sound and the family stays clear of disposing oil down the drain.
Sewer cleaning is about recovering flow, but that does not imply giving up the lawn or the pathway. Alexandria's slim lots often conceal the sewer lateral underneath yard beds and rock sidewalks. A thoughtful sewer cleaning company phases hose pipes and machines to shield plantings and stays clear of unnecessary excavation. Begin with every available cleanout. If the property does not have one near the front, it might deserve installing a brand-new cleanout at the property line. That solitary renovation can turn a half-day battle right into a one-hour upkeep job.
Cabling a sewage system ought to be a determined process. If roots are present, a series of progressively larger blades is much better than jumping to the optimum dimension and chewing the joint right into an unequal birthed. Cam evaluation after the very first pass informs you where the origins are going into. Many Alexandria laterals have a short clay sector from your home to the sidewalk, after that a PVC substitute to the city major. The change is where origins attack. When you recognize the exact area, you can reduce easily and discuss whether a place repair service, liner, or proceeded maintenance makes sense.
Grease in a sewer is less common for single-family homes, however multi-unit structures and homes with basement cooking areas see it a lot more. Jetting excels here, with a final pass of cozy water to carry the slurry downstream. If multiple units add to the line, the timetable matters as high as the technique. Collaborating a building-wide kitchen area time out during the service avoids fresh discharge from moving oil into a newly cleaned up segment.
Not every flaw warrants instant substitute. I carry a set of instances in my head from work where perseverance and upkeep worked far better than a thrill to dig. A property owner on a tree-lined street had origins at a single joint, 6 feet from the aesthetic. We reduced them clean, jetted the line, and saw a small offset on electronic camera without much dirt noticeable. As opposed to trench a stone pathway and interfere with the well-known boxwoods, we arranged origin re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dosage of origin control foam after the springtime growth flush. That was eight years earlier. The walkway is intact, and overall upkeep prices still rest listed below the price of excavation by a wide margin.
On the other hand, I have seen tummies that hold 2 inches of water over a long stretch. Electronic camera video footage shows paper sitting in the dip, relocating only with heavy flows. In those situations, no amount of jetting changes the geometry. You can keep around a belly, but you will certainly deal with regular downturns and more stringent policies about what decreases. If the stubborn belly r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the repair service with the paving. You just want to excavate once.

Some behaviors bring more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the villains they are made out to be, but they can be abused. Coffee premises are great in small amounts if purged with great deals of water, yet they end up being mortar when blended with grease.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es identified "flushable" distribute slowly and tangle in rough pipeline wall surfaces. Soap scum in older bathtubs is extra about water chemistry and low-flow fixtures than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and periodic enzyme maintenance assistance keep those lines honest.
A well-timed warm water flush after greasy food preparation evenings makes a distinction. Run the faucet on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old oil, yet it presses soft residues out of the catch arm and right into larger diameter pipe where they are less most likely to stick. For washing, spacing tons avoids a rise that bewilders limited standpipes. If your camera revealed a belly, that spacing is not optional.
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and fixing as the restoration. Cabling is accurate for tough blockages, roots, and localized ob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, oil, sludge, and scale. Repair service or lining solves geometry problems, broken sectors, and significant intrusions.
If your primary has a single origin invasion at a joint and the pipeline is or else strong, cabling complied with by root-specific jetting offers you clean wall surfaces and a much longer interval between check outs. If your kitchen area line is slow-moving each month and the electronic camera reveals heavy oil lengthwise, jetting is worth the financial investment. If the electronic camera shows a collapse, a deep stomach, or a significant balanced out, avoid repeated cleansing and cost the repair service. In Alexandria, several laterals are superficial near your home and much deeper near the visual. Finding the issue might disclose a fixing just three feet deep next to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Roadway, three neighbors called within two months with the exact same issue: slow-moving first-floor bathrooms, gurgling bathtub drains, and occasional basement floor drainpipe dampness after storms. The common factor was a clay segment prior to the city major, invaded by origins. Each home had a different design, yet the camera told the same tale. The very first house owner went with biannual origin cutting. The 2nd chose hydro jetting plus a foam origin therapy. The 3rd set up an area repair prior to a planned outdoor patio renovation. A year later on, all three stayed delighted, each with a remedy matched to their budget and tolerance for recurring maintenance.
In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a family fought with a kitchen area line that clogged every six weeks. The run took a trip with an ended up ceiling and transformed twice in the past going down to the primary. Wire passes opened circulation, however oil returned rapidly. We jetted the line with a tiny spinning nozzle at moderate stress, then flushed with warm water and degreaser. The video camera revealed a clean, intense inside. We relocated the air admission valve to improve airing vent, which lowered the sink's sluggishness. With absolutely nothing else altered, they went eighteen months prior to the next service phone call, and that one was for a washroom sink catch, not the kitchen.

If a solitary fixture is slow-moving, clear the trap and check the air vent. Occasionally a bird nest or a leaf mat on a level roofing air vent produces negative pressure that mimics a clog. For a stubborn kitchen area sink that is still draining slowly, a long, stable warm water run can press soft oil past a sticky area. Avoid putting chemicals right into the drain. They can shed a technology during solution, and they hardly ever touch the real blockage. If numerous fixtures at the lowest degree are supporting, quit using water and ask for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water threats flooding and damage, and any extra disc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Plumbers use tools such as drain snakes, augers, and hydro jetting systems. They may inspect the drain with a camera to locate the blockage. The method chosen depends on clog type, pipe material, and drain location. The goal is to fully remove debris without damaging pipes.
Drains should only need unclogging when signs of blockage appear. Preventive cleaning is typically recommended every 1โ2 years for high-use drains. Homes with older plumbing or frequent clogs may need more frequent service. Regular maintenance helps avoid emergencies.
Plumbers mechanically break up or flush out the blockage using professional equipment. Snaking cuts through debris, while hydro jetting uses high-pressure water to clean pipe walls. Camera inspections help confirm the clog is fully cleared. The approach depends on severity and drain type.
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led โflushable,โ because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.
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
